A florist uses 160 roses and 42 tulips to make 5 identical flower arrangements. How many roses would the florist use to create 8 identical arrangements

You can use ratios to answer this. If you need 160 roses for 5 arrangements, than you will need 32 (160/5) roses in each arrangement.

For 8 arrangements, this would be 256 roses (32 x 8).
